Transaction 66f29890f5be2a51926629cdc8f1208473c48b311e9c24db8c981ca5cf4e64b5

1 Input
2 Outputs
  • 66f29890f5be2a51926629cdc8f1208473c48b311e9c24db8c981ca5cf4e64b5:0
  • value  365543
    address  1LDktmkKXAZhG3UPAC5oA2M4uxknurJTeq
  • 66f29890f5be2a51926629cdc8f1208473c48b311e9c24db8c981ca5cf4e64b5:1
  • value  6429903
    address  33jefoeL7mb31kPdojpHAbxQSZvGiHF1sc